- Description
- Distilled in May 1993 and aged 25 years in a single bourbon hogshead, this Springbank was bottled by Master of Malt in November 2018 at 51% ABV. The bourbon cask allows the distillery's characteristic briny, funky character to shine with subtle oak influence and a long, maritime finish.
